Título:
A combined theoretical and experimental study on the oxidation of fulvic acid by the sulfate radical anion
Autor/es:
P.M. DAVID GARA; G.N. BOSIO; MÓNICA C. GONZÁLEZ; NINO RUSSO; MARIA C MICHELINI; REINALDO PIS DIEZ; DANIEL O. MÁRTIRE
Revista:
Photochem. Photobiol. Sci.
Editorial:
RSC
Referencias:
Año: 2009 vol. 8 p. 992 - 997
Resumen:
The kinetics of the reaction of sulfate radicals with the IHSS Waskish peat fulvic acid in water wasinvestigated in the temperature range from 289.2 to 305.2 K. The proposed mechanism considers thereversible binding of the sulfate radicals by the fulvic acid. The kinetic analysis of the data allows thedetermination of the thermodynamic parameters DG◦ = -10.2 kcal mol-1, DH◦ = -16 kcal mol-1 andDS◦ = -20.3 cal K-1 mol-1 for the reversible association at 298.2 K. Theoretical (DFT) calculationsperformed with the Buffle model of the fulvic acids support the formation of H-bonded adductsbetween the inorganic radicals and the humic substances. The experimental enthalpy change compareswell with the theoretical values found for some of the investigated adducts.
